We have SSO enabled as well as workflow notifications using Extended
Notifications. We have attachments to our email notifications that currently
launch the executable item in SAP GUI. This launching asks the user to sign
in and doesn't use SSO. We found the setting below...

In transaction SWNCONFIG under general settings the help says the following:
Parameter: SAPLOGON_ID: Generic ID that is required for Single Sign-On.
Ensure that all users who are to receive notifications use this ID in the
SAP Logon. If the ID specified here is not identical to the ID in a user's
SAP Logon, then the user must log on to the system separately to display or
execute a work item.
Format: <System name>[<Application group name>]   Example: ABC[SSO]
